Double Up with Fresh Bucks in August & September at Farmers Markets

Do you want to join in the bounty of the season?  Well, you can at 7 Farmers Markets throughout the city where you are able to double your purchase power. 
Just swipe your EBT card for $10 and get $20 worth of produce.  The 7 farmers markets participating are:
 ·         University District and Magnolia Farmers Markets on Saturdays
·         West Seattle and Broadway Farmers Markets on Sundays
·         Columbia City Farmers Market on Wednesdays
·         Lake City Farmers Market on Thursdays
·         Phinney Farmers Market on Fridays
Weekend hours are at least 11am-2pm & weekday hours are 3pm-7pm
Just go the information booth at the farmers market & a staff person will swipe your EBT card up to $10 and give you up to $10 in Fresh Bucks, to be used at the market on more fruits and vegetables. 
For more information about the Fresh Bucks program, including the locations of these markets, see here!
This offer is good throughout August & September.  If you get the bucks in September, you may use them on produce up until Halloween.

Foot Care Day is this Monday, August 20

Do you have tough toe nails?  Are they hard to cut?  Nurses will provide nail care at no charge on a first come, first serve basis at the Ballard Homeless Clinic of Neighborcare Health.  They are located at 5710 22nd Ave NW which is just across from the library in uptown Ballard.  Busses 44, 17, 18 & 75 can get you there.

So if you’d like to pay attention to those precious feet that get you all around, stop by at the Ballard Homeless Clinic for a nail trim on Monday, August 20th.
